FAQ

How warm does it get in Sedgwick County?
The average annual highest temperature in Sedgwick County is 34.6°C (94.3°F), and the July 21st is the hottest day on average.
How cold does it get in Sedgwick County?
The average annual lowest temperature in Sedgwick County is -11.8°C (10.8°F), and the December 28th is the coldest day on average.
Which month has the most rain in Sedgwick County?
The wettest months in Sedgwick County are May and June.
What months does it snow in Sedgwick County?
The most common time of year for snow is February, March, April, December, November and January.
